Tehran - FNA
Jordan security officials confirmed that they have arrested three Salafi militants they believe have direct link to the Al-Nusra Front in Syria. The three men, identified as security risks by Jordan officials were apprehended last Saturday as they were on their way to Daraa in Syria, Islam Times reported. Keen to crackdown on Muslim Sunni radicals, the Jordanian authorities have conducted a series of mass arrests in Amman, Zaraq and Irbid. About 20 militants were as a result prevented from entering Syria where they planned on joining militia groups.
